CASA is a county-based child advocacy program whose goal is to speak up inside and outside of court for abused, neglected, and drug-exposed children and help ensure that every child's voice is heard and has an effect on the outcome of their case.
As a case travels through DCS and the juvenile court system, often the needs, wants and wishes of a child are overlooked or not heard due to the sheer amount of other concerns the team has to address, overwhelming DCS caseloads, and the noise of the court proceedings. As a CASA, you can ensure that this doesn't happen and advocate for the best interests of the child themselves. As a court-appointed volunteer you hold the authority of the court as you investigate, interview, and get to personally know all the details of a case and every individual involved in it.
It is your job to report directly to the local judge and help them make an informed, child-centered judgement that will greatly increase the chances of a positive outcome of the case--be it adoption, reunification, or other result.
